One cup of Black bean cake is around 238 grams and contains approximately 476 calories, 24.0 grams of protein, 12 grams of fat, and 71.0 grams of carbohydrates.
Black Bean Cake is a delectable dessert that combines the rich, earthy flavor of black beans with sweet cocoa and a hint of vanilla. Originating from Latin American cuisine, this unique treat is not only delicious but also packed with nutrition. Black beans provide a great source of protein and fiber, making it a healthier alternative to traditional cakes. The addition of natural sweeteners keeps sugar levels in check, while the gluten-free option makes it suitable for various dietary preferences.
